They were just simple white Lunch Sack/Paper type bags. They had some of the Graceful Greenery Vellum and Berries and Pearls Adhesives. Along with some Christmas goodies. And chocolate. Must have chocolate. 🙂
For the bags I diecut the paper using the Perennial Postage Dies. It was a wide enough strip that was to have the bottom edge over the paper and the rest of the strip went through the inside of the die to lie on top. If that makes sense. Just so the bottom edge would be cut. The paper was retired paper from last year.
The label was diecut from the Greetings of the Seaon dies and the words were from the stamp set. To finish I diecut a green leaf spray with the Golden Greenery Dies and a Pearl to finish.

Wednesday’s WOW! #164 – Creating a masked background.
Here’s a technique for you to try sometime. You can create a masked frame and add colour to the centre area.
To do this use the Masking Paper to add strips around the edge of your card leaving a rectangle or square shape in the middle. Using the Brayer or the Blending Brushes roll (or brush) over your ink. Try different colours to create a coloured background.
Once you are done gently remove the masking paper and stamp over your images. Stamping them in black ink will really highlight them against the background. Then it is a matter of adding a simple greeting.

New products are arriving Online from tomorrow (July 3rd). I will bring you more news about those later but today I wanted to show you a card I made recently with one of these new bundles. This is with the Frosted Forest Bundle.
The Frosted Forest Bundle comes with a stamp set, dies and masks. The stamp set has a number of different trees, great for any occasion. The masks have 2-3 masks for each tree so you can layer the colours on the image. I like that because I’m not a huge fan of colouring.
I will show you the bundle more later but for now I couldn’t wait to share the card. I used Pecan Pie for the trunk and Old Olive for the tree. Using the different layers added to the depth of the tree branches.
With the sentiment I added a sticky note over the full sentiment and just showed the Thinking of You on a small strip of Crushed Curry. Then I snipped the sentiment in half to separate it for the card.
